    The Vibe

    Hany's Grill reads like a neighbourhood institution: a street-level grill in Amsterdam’s Rivierenbuurt that serves a steady roster of local regulars rather than guidebook-driven visitors. The tone is practical and unpretentious, anchored by classic grilled dishes and a fixed address on Scheldestraat. Sitting amid 1930s residential architecture, the restaurant feels rooted in its quieter southside context, offering a relaxed, dependable counterpoint to the city’s high-end tasting-menu rooms. It presents itself as everyday and familiar—the sort of place locals rely on for a solid meal any night of the week.

    Best For

    Hany's is best for neighbourhood dining occasions where familiarity and straightforward grilled food matter more than spectacle. It suits families, groups and regulars who want a reliable steak or ribs in a relaxed setting, and it works well as an after-work or midweek dinner spot—descriptions note the place fills on a Tuesday because residents depend on it. The clientele skews local rather than tourist-facing, so visitors looking for an authentic, community-oriented grill experience find it especially appropriate.

    Ordering Tips

    Keep orders simple and focused on the signatures that define the menu: the Ribeye Steak, Hany's Burger Speciaal and Hany's Ribs are highlighted as standouts. Because the concept centers on grilled classics, prioritize the main grilled plates rather than searching for tasting-menu-style experimentation. Expect straightforward preparations and portion-driven plates intended to satisfy a neighbourhood crowd; if you want to sample the house style, start with one of the signature mains to understand what regulars come back for.
